    I guessed it was a fake account when I read your first post. No idea why people bid on items with no intention of buying - not only are they wasting the sellers time but they are also wasting their own time. Obviously nothing better to do with their time, some people need to get out more :)

    If in doubt, you can click on the advanced search option on eBay and type in the buyers user ID, it will show all items they have bid on. Ebay really should bring back the negative feedback option for buyers that don't pay for items.

    Have you relisted the item on auction? I would have put it on BUY IT NOW with best offer and require immediate payment. If there is someone local who wants to collect and pay on collection then all you would have to do is up the buy it now price so no one else will buy it immdiately but can still put in offers which you can accept - that way if the buyer fails to collect your item is still available for sale.
